Architectural & Marine Protection Film in Miami

Expensive surfaces get damaged - scratches, stains, UV fade, chemical exposure. Protection film is a transparent barrier applied directly over the original material. It absorbs the damage. The surface underneath stays untouched. When the film wears out, replace the film - not the countertop, the marble, or the yacht hull.

Marine Protection Film

Miami's marine environment is unforgiving - saltwater, UV, dock rash, fuel, ropes, fenders, fish blood, and constant impact. Marine PPF creates a sacrificial barrier over gelcoat and painted surfaces.

What It Prevents

  • Scratches, scuffs, dock rash, trailer damage
  • Saltwater oxidation and UV degradation
  • Permanent staining from fuel, sunscreen, bird droppings, algae
  • Gloss loss and discoloration over time

Marine PPF Features

  • Self-healing technology - light scratches disappear with heat exposure
  • Hydrophobic coating - water beads off, mineral deposits reduced
  • Preserves resale value of the vessel
  • Manufacturer warranty up to 12 years
  • Replaces need for frequent polishing and repainting
